My husband was diagnosed 21 years ago, after a sleep study confirmed RBD. A sleep specialist will prescribe a drug (my husband takes clonazepam) PLUS 15 mg. of melatonin. Sounds like alot, but the melatonin is titrated to the amount of the prescribed drug. It seems to be the right combination for him. After many episodes, similar to the ones you have mentioned, we have been in separate bedrooms for years, and I certainly sleep better that way! After 20 years of having RBD, he was finally diagnosed with Parkinson's. At this time, he is doing well.
